Gramática

Article errors

× Yes, I often go to library to read books and and to debate with others.

Yes, I often go to the library to read books and to debate with others.

The noun 'library' needs the definite article 'the' because it refers to a specific place the speaker commonly visits. Use 'the library' instead of 'library'. Also removed the duplicated 'and'. Suggestion: Always consider whether a place you regularly visit requires 'the' (the library, the bank) and proofread for repeated words.

Sentence structure errors

× It's because in my hometown library there is there are some programs to debate about books, so like book concert or or book debates.

It's because in my hometown the library has some programs to debate books, such as book talks or book debates.

Mixed use of 'there is' and 'there are' creates confusion and redundancy. Also 'debate about books' is awkward; 'programs to debate books' or 'book debates' is clearer. 'Book concert' is unclear—'book talks' or 'author talks' is more natural. Removed duplicated 'or'. Suggestion: Use a single structure ('the library has') and choose clear nouns for events.

Sentence structure errors

× So I associate.

So I get involved.

'Associate' is not used correctly here; it usually requires 'with' or refers to a person. The intended meaning is participation or involvement, so 'I get involved' or 'I participate' is appropriate. Suggestion: Use verbs that match intended action (associate with = be connected; participate/get involved = take part).

Incorrect use of adjectives or adverbs

× I really love to read some fantasy and romance novel, so I read them.

I really love to read fantasy and romance novels, so I read them.

'Novel' should be plural 'novels' to match 'fantasy and romance' as categories. Also 'some' is unnecessary before genres. Use plural with countable nouns when speaking generally. Suggestion: Use plural form for countable nouns when referring to the category (romance novels).

Article errors

× Sometimes I go there to study my homework or other things.

Sometimes I go there to do my homework or study other things.

In English, you 'do' homework, not 'study homework'. Reordered phrase to 'do my homework' and 'study other things' for clarity. Suggestion: Learn common collocations: do homework, study for exams.

Sentence structure errors

× The atmosphere is very calm and very helpful for.

The atmosphere is very calm and very helpful for studying.

Sentence ends abruptly with a preposition 'for' lacking an object. Add the object 'studying' to complete the idea and make it meaningful. Suggestion: Ensure prepositions have objects (helpful for studying).

Article errors

× Yes, when I was younger, I usually went to library with my family and friends.

Yes, when I was younger, I usually went to the library with my family and friends.

'Library' requires the definite article 'the' when referring to a specific place regularly visited in the past. Suggestion: Use 'the' for specific, known places.

Incorrect use of adverbs

× My father really loved to really loved to go to library because he is a heavy reader.

My father really loved to go to the library because he is a heavy reader.

Phrase 'really loved to really loved to' is duplicated; remove repetition. Add 'the' before 'library'. Keep tense consistent: 'loved' (past) is fine with 'is a heavy reader' if he still reads a lot; consider 'was a heavy reader' if not. Suggestion: Avoid repeating words and maintain article use.

Past tense issue

× So umm he really he usually umm bring brought me to there and sometimes I when.

So he usually brought me there, and sometimes I went by myself.

Mixed verb forms and incorrect phrasing: 'bring brought' is redundant; use past tense 'brought'. 'to there' is incorrect—use 'there' without 'to'. The fragment 'and sometimes I when' is incomplete; complete as 'and sometimes I went by myself.' Suggestion: Keep past tense consistent for past events and avoid extra auxiliaries; use correct verb forms and complete clauses.

Incorrect use of pronouns

× I don't know I'm Koreans but I think Chinese kids also often go to library because umm.

I don't know, I'm Korean, but I think Chinese kids also often go to the library because...

'I'm Koreans' is incorrect: use singular 'Korean' for 'I'. 'Library' needs 'the'. Added commas for clarity and ellipsis to reflect trailing off. Suggestion: Use correct singular noun for nationality after 'I am' and include articles for specific places.

Incorrect use of adjectives or adverbs

× I heard that Chinese pers people really try to study hard to become successful so I think they will too.

I heard that Chinese people really try to study hard to become successful, so I think they do too.

'Pers' is a typo; remove it. 'They will too' is odd for a general present habit—use 'they do too' or 'they also do.' Added comma before 'so'. Suggestion: Use present simple for habitual actions (they study hard; they do too) and proofread typos.
